A hallmark of the Russian bare experience is the "wild" beach or Dikiy Plyazh . Across the Black Sea coast, the Crimea, and even the riverbanks of the Volga, naturists seek out secluded, rugged locations. These sites are rarely manicured resorts; they are rocky, forest-lined, or remote sandy stretches where the focus is on a quiet connection with nature rather than social amenities.
